[ETC] NSIS Comsori 2015. 10. 16. 12:50

음... 깔끔하게 포스팅을 하려고 하다가..

 

일단은.. 참고 할 수 있는 사이트 링크를.. 살포시..

 

http://blog.naver.com/ratmsma/40028387013

 

http://skql.tistory.com/505

 

위 두군데에서 보면 NSIS를 어느정도 입맛에 맞게 할 수가 있다.

 

NSIS는 무료 배포 패키지를 만드는 프로그램인데..

 

오픈소스 기반에 에디터에서 기본적인 스크립트를 생성을 해 주니 편하다.

 

거기에서 이제 등록 화면들을 자체적으로 수정해서 쓰면 되니..

 

일반적인 배포 프로그램 만드는 것보다 이게 훨씬 수월한 느낌...

EE버전 헬리우스를 실행하는데 갑자기 떠서 놀랬다

하지만..

eclipse.ini 파일을 열어서

openFile 아래에

-vm
C:\Program Files\Java\jdk1.6.0_22\bin\javaw.exe

를 추가해주면 된다... -_- 닷넷하다가 자바하려니 이클립스가 시비다 ㅠ_ㅠ
Active X에 대한 권한 문제가 큰 것 같다

지금 같은 경우 찾아서 cmd에서 /u 명령어를 이용하여 해제를 했다만..(regsvr32 /u 파일)

매번 이렇게 나온다면.. 골치 아픈데..

암만 찾아봐도 하나씩 찾아서 없애 주는 것 외엔 방법이 없었다..

누가 가르쳐 주셨음 좋겠는데...


MS에서 이번에 재미있는 툴을 내 놓았다

라이트스위치

ZDNET엣어 기사를 봤는데.. 매력적이긴한데..

코더들만을 양성하게 되는.. 문제가 생기지 않을까..

http://zdnet.co.kr/Contents/2010/08/05/zdnet20100805102517.htm
[Comsori] VS2010!! Comsori 2010. 7. 28. 17:56
http://onoffmix.com/event/1676#attend

다들 신청하세요!! 이번 2010의 경우.. 재밋는 것들이 많을 것 같아요!!
[Comsori]USB 인식 제어 Comsori 2009. 12. 7. 15:36
개발을 하면서 USB에 대한 제어때문에 고민을 했다.

디바이스 제어하는 API가 존재하기는 하지만

정확한 자료가 없었다.

그래서!! 차선 책으로 채용한 것이 윈도우 레지스트를 손대자!!

먼저 regedit 를 실행한 후

H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\ 에서 StorageDevicePolicies 키 값을 만든다

그리고 DWORD값을 WriteProtect라고 한 후 그 값을 1로 주면

읽기 전용이 되어 저장, 복사, 삭제등은 할 수가 없다.

다시 원래대로 이용하고 싶으면 0으로 하면된다.

어느 누군가 C# 코드단으로 제어하는 방법을 알면 가르쳐 주셨음 좋겠습니다 .ㅠ_ㅠ
 

제어판상에서 컴퓨터 관리에서 우리는 서비스를 확인 할 수 있다.

이 서비스를 도스 창에서 삭제하고 등록하는 법은 다음과 같다.

만약 기존에 등록된 서비스가 돌아가고 있다면 일단 중지를 한다.

그리고 sc delete 서비스명을 치면 삭제가 된다.

서비스를 설치 할 경우는  C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322

폴더 아래에서 installUtil  "설치 exe파일 Full Path"

를 치면 등록이 되며

installUtil /u "설치 exe파일 Full Path" 를 입력을 하면 삭제가 된다.

윈도우즈 상에서 서비스를 등록하고 이용하는 프로그램을 만드는 사람이라면..

당연히 알고 있어야 할 듯 하다.

그럼 슈슉~

[ETC]CSV 파일 형식 Comsori 2009. 4. 6. 10:43

CSV 파일은 , 로 구분된다.

단 ,를 포함한 데이터는 " " 로 묶어서 저장이된다.

" 문자 처리의 경우 개행문자 처리처럼 "" 형태로 나타나며

문자와 연결시 " " 로 문자를 묶은 후 " 처리를 한다

EX) a" -> "a"""

제어판 바로실행 명령어 입니다. 참고하세요.
Contrl Panel의 약자로, 제어판에 나타나는 설정 항목 파일이며, EXE파일과 같이 실행이 가능하다. 일례로 디스플레이 항목의 파일인 desk.cpl파일은 더블 클릭하면 디스플레이 등록 정보가 실행된다. 각 제어판의 항목과 해당 CPL파일의 이름은 다음과 같다.

control  제어판
Access.cpl 
내게 필요한 옵션
appwiz.cpl  
프로그램 추가/제거
bthprops.cpl  
블루투스장치설정
desk.cpl  
디스플레이 등록정보
firewall.cpl   Windows
방화벽
hdwwiz.cpl  
새하드웨어추가마법사
inetcpl.cpl  
인터넷 등록정보
intl.cpl  
국가 및 언어옵션
irprops.cpl  
적외선포트 설정
joy.cpl  
게임컨트롤러
main.cpl  
마우스등록정보
mmsys.cpl  
사운드및 오디오장치등록정보
ncpa.cpl  
네트워크연결
netsetup.cpl  
네트워크설정마법사
nusrmgr.cpl  
사용자계정
nwc.cpl  
네트워크 게이트웨이
odbccp32.cpl   ODBC
데이터원본 관리자
powercfg.cpl   
전원옵션 등록정보
sysdm.cpl  
시스템등록정보
telephon.cpl  
전화및모뎀 옵션  
timedate.cpl  
날짜 및 시간 등록정보

wscui.cpl   Windows
보안센터
wuaucpl.cpl  
자동업데이트
Sapi.cpl  
텍스트 음성 변환설정
control Admintools  
관리도구
control Folders  
폴더옵션
control Userpasswords  
사용자 계정


관리콘솔 명령어
certmgr.msc : 인증서
ciadv.msc :
인덱싱서비스
ntmsmgr.msc :
이동식저장소
ntmsoprq.msc :
이동식저장소 운영자 요청
secpol.msc :
로컬보안정책
wmimgmt.msc : WMI(Windows Management Infrastructure)
compmgmt.msc :
컴퓨터 관리
devmgmt.msc :
장치관리자
diskmgmt.msc :
디스크 관리
dfrg.msc :
디스크 조각모음
eventvwr.msc :
이벤트 뷰어
fsmgmt.msc :
공유폴더
gpedit.msc :
로컬 컴퓨터 정책
lusrmgr.msc :
로컬 사용자 및 그룹
perfmon.msc :
성능모니터뷰
rsop.msc :
정책의 결과와 집합
secpol.msc :
로컬 보안설정
services.msc :
서비스
C:\WINDOWS\system32\Com\comexp.msc :
구성요소서비스
C:\WINDOWS\Microsoft.NET\Framework\v1.1.4322\mscorcfg.msc : .NET Configuration 1.1

기타 실행 명령어
cmd : 도스명령프롬프트 실행,  , 98 command
shutdown -i : GUI
화면으로 시스템 종료, 재부팅 가능

shutdown -a :
종료 설정 중지
netstat :
인터넷 접속 상황
ipconfig /all : ip
주소,게이트웨이,서브넷마스크, DNS서버주소,physical주소
dxdiag :
다이렉트 - X 상태 정보 화면
cleanmgr :
디스크 정리
regedit  :
레지스트리 편집기
netsetup :
네트워크 설정 마법사
calc :
계산기
charmap :
문자표
pbrush , mspaint  :
그림판
cleanmgr :
디스크정리
clipbrd :
클립보드에 복사된 내용 표시
control :
제어판
dxdiag :
다이렉트X 진단도구 및 그래픽과 사운드의 세부정보를 보여줌
eudcedit  :
용자 정의 문자 편집기
explorer :
탐색기
magnify :
돋보기
osk :
화상키보드
winmine :
지뢰찾기
sndrec32
녹음기
wordpad :
워드패드
sndvol32 :
시스템 사운드 등록정보,볼륨조절
sysedit : autoexec.bat, config.sys, win.ini, system.ini
시스템구성편집기
systray :
사운드 볼륨설정 노란색 스피커 아이콘을 트라이목록에 띄움
mobsync :
동기화
msconfig :
시스템 구성요소 유틸리티
msinfo32 :
시스템정보
mstsc :
원격 데스크톱 연결
netstat -na :
현재 열린포트와 TCP/IP 프로토콜정보를 보여줌, 열린포트로 트라이목마형 바이러스 침투 유무확인가능
notepad :
메모장
wab :
주소록
ntbackup :
백업 및 복원 마법사
ping
사이트주소 : 핑테스트 해당 사이트의 인터넷연결 유무 확인
sfc :
시스템 파일 검사기. 시스템 파일을 검사한후 깨지거난 손실된 파일을 원본 압축파일에서 찾아서 복원시켜줌 . , 2000에서는 cmd실행 후 sfc사용 - 마지막 설정된 값을 다음 윈도우부팅시 곧바로 실행됨[수정]
telnet open
사이트주소 : 텔넷접속명령어

tourstart :
윈도우 기능안내 html 문서표시
winipcfg :
인터넷에 접속된 자신의 아이피 주소를 보여줌) , 2000 ipconfig로 변경됨
winver :
윈도우 버전확인
wmplayer :
윈도우 미디어 플레이어
wupdmgr :
윈도우업데이트

-_- 그냥... 무지 간단하다..

다른거 필요없다;;

혹여나 모르시는 분들을 위해;;

필자도 오랜만에 해본 것이라서 잊을까봐;;

일단 허브에 해당 랜선을 다 꽂는다 -_- 물론 컴퓨터에도 꽂아야겠죠?

그 다음.. -_- DNS를 제외한 IP와 Subnetmask, Gateway를 입력하면.. 끝이다..

아 참고로 -_- 오라클이나 SQL같은 Datadase도 연결 가능하겠죠?^_^

네!! 가능합니다!!